Sample Analysis by:
Polarized Light Microscopy-Dispersion Staining (PLM-DS)
Method of Sammle Prenaration and Analysis:
All samples were prepared and analyzed in accordance with the EPA "Method for the Determination of Asbestos in
Bulk Building Materials" USEPA/ 600/R-93/116, July, 1993
Olympus PLM, Model BH-2/VM stereomicroscope Model VMZ lx-4x.
Analytical results reflect the make up of the materials only in the areas sampled. This "Summary of Analytical Results" shall not be reproduced except
in full, without the written approval of JLC Laboratory, and it must not be used by client to claim product endorsement by NVLAP or any agency of the
U.S. Government. This method is not applicable to samples containing large amounts of fine fibers below the resolution of the light microscope. The
value of this method is limited to the quantitative identification of asbestos and the semi-quantitative determination of asbestos content of bulk samples,
expressed as a percentage of the projected area. Quantitation of asbestos content was determined with a visual volume estimate, a calibrated visual
area estimate, and/or point counting procedure. CAUTION: Other fibers with optical properties similar to asbestos may give positive interferences
and will be considered asbestos under this methodology. Also, PLM is not consistently reliable in detecting asbestos in floor coverings and similar
non-friable organically bound materials. Quantitative transmission electron microscopy is currently the only method that can be used to determine
if this material can be considered or treated as non-asbestos containing.
